2 weeks on site in Chicago monthly required
The Java Architect drives the translation and construction of a client's business problems into innovative technology solutions by creating and owning the technical vision of the project and ensuring that the vision is achieved with a high level of quality. They are also responsible for mentoring and coaching people and providing technology- related thought leadership, including supporting sales activities.
Your Impact:
- As a Java Architect, you will help to realize high-end technology solutions for our clients
- You will guide the development, design, user interface, technology integration, and site architecture
- You will engage in business development, as well as in building and maintaining client relationships
Your Skills & Experience:
- 8+ years of experience with good understanding of Core Java basic concepts likes OOPS, classes, inheritance and polymorphism, java collections
- Well versed with JDK 8 features or above and good understanding of multi threading, Java concurrency package
- Should have good understanding of Java design pattern such as chain of commands, domain driven design(DDD), singleton etc.
- Good understanding of general integration styles and related patterns like Channel patterns, Routing Patterns, Transformation patterns and Endpoint patterns
- Working experience with Java frameworks like :
- Spring Projects - spring MVC, spring core, spring batch, spring cloud
- ORM - JDBC template, Hibernate, Ibatis
- Working experience and understanding of any of the Java based integration technologies:
- Spring Boot
- Kafka
- ActiveMQ
- Enterprise BUS
- Apache Camel
- Apache Flink
- Experience with CI/CD using Jenkins/Git/Kubernetes/Docker/Containerization
- Experience with Cloud Technologies - Azure Cloud Services and/or AWS
- Good to have experience with Asynchronous and reactive programming
Horizontal is proud to be an Equal Opportunity and Affirmative Action Employer. We seek to provide employment opportunities to talented, qualified candidates regardless of race, color, sex/gender including gender identity and/or expression, national origin, religion, sexual orientation, disability, marital status, citizen status, veteran status, or any other protected classification under federal, state or local law.
In addition, Horizontal will provide reasonable accommodations for qualified individuals with disabilities. If you need to request a reasonable accommodation in order to complete the application or interview process, please contact hr@horizontal.com.
All applicants applying must be legally authorized to work in the country of employment.
Success!
You have saved your first job! To see all your Saved Jobs, click here. Or continue scrolling through jobs and bookmark openings that catch your eye and apply for those jobs later.
We’re sorry!
There are currently no open positions in your location or accepting applications from out of the country
Return to Home